Understanding Mobile Car Key Replacement
Mobile online car key replacement key replacement involves a technician going to a consumer's place to either replace a lost key or program a new one for the vehicle. This service can be a lifesaver for those who find themselves locked out of their cars or in requirement of a spare key and can not make it to a dealer or locksmith professional. The procedure is typically fast, effective, and cost-effective.
Key Services Offered
Mobile car key replacement remote key for car services usually provide a variety of alternatives, including:
Key Duplication: Creating an extra key from an existing one, perfect for families or to have a backup key.Key Fob Replacement: Replacing or reprogramming key fobs for modern automobiles equipped with remote access functions.Transponder Key Programming: Programming a new transponder key that operates utilizing a microchip to communicate with the vehicle's ignition system.Lockout Services: Gaining access to a locked vehicle when the keys are misplaced or locked within.Advantages of Mobile Car Key Replacement

The procedure of mobile car key replacement can vary based on the specific service and vehicle type, but normally follows a similar series:
Initial Consultation: The client contacts the mobile key service provider to discuss the problem (lost key, broken key, etc).Recognition and Verification: The technician will confirm the customer's identity and validate vehicle ownership (typically requires ID and vehicle registration).Assessment: The professional examines the car's make, design, and year to determine the required key type and programs needed.Key Cutting and Programming: If a new key is needed, the specialist will cut and program it on-site to ensure it functions correctly.Checking: The specialist checks the brand-new key or fob how to get a replacement car key guarantee it works with the ignition and locks.Payment and Final Instructions: Once the service is complete, the consumer spends for the service, and the technician supplies any extra instructions for future usage.Elements to Consider When Choosing a Mobile Key Replacement Service

How much does mobile car key replacement cost?
Costs can differ significantly based upon elements such as the type of key, vehicle make and design, and area. Generally, you can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300 for mobile key replacement services.
2. For how long does it require to replace a car key?
A lot of mobile car key replacement services can finish the job within 30 to 60 minutes, depending on the key type and intricacy of the shows.
3. Do I require to have my original key to get a replacement?
In most cases, having the original key is not necessary. Technicians can typically produce a new key using the vehicle identification number (VIN) or through the car's lock system.
4. Will a mobile key replacement service void my car service warranty?
Mobile key replacement key services do not usually void car guarantees. Nevertheless, it is constantly best to inspect your warranty terms and speak with your dealership if in doubt.
5. Can I configure my car key myself?
Some keys can be programmed by the owner, depending on the car design. Nevertheless, for a lot of contemporary lorries with transponder keys or wise fobs, professional shows is suggested.
